* @note
*
* Flags in FSBL
*
* FSBL_PERF
*
* This Flag can be set at compilation time. This flag is set for
* measuring the performance of FSBL.That is the time taken to execute is
* measured.when this flag is set.Execution time with reference to
* global timer is taken here
*
* Total Execution time is the time taken for executing FSBL till handoff
* to any application .
* If there is a bitstream in the partition header then the
* execution time includes the copying of the bitstream to DDR
* (in case of SD/NAND bootmode)
* and programming the devcfg dma is accounted.
*
* FSBL provides two debug levels
* DEBUG GENERAL - fsbl_printf under this category will appear only when the
* FSBL_DEBUG flag is set during compilation
* DEBUG_INFO - fsbl_printf under this category will appear when the
* FSBL_DEBUG_INFO flag is set during compilation
* For a more detailed output log can be used.
* FSBL_DEBUG_RSA - Define this macro to print more detailed values used in
* RSA functions
* These macros are input to the fsbl_printf function
*
* DEBUG LEVELS
* FSBL_DEBUG level is level 1, when this flag is set all the fsbl_prints
* that are with the DEBUG_GENERAL argument are shown
* FSBL_DEBUG_INFO is level 2, when this flag is set during the
* compilation , the fsbl_printf with DEBUG_INFO will appear on the com port
*
* DEFAULT LEVEL
* By default no print messages will appear.
*
* NON_PS_INSTANTIATED_BITSTREAM
*
* FSBL will not enable the level shifters for a NON PS instantiated
* Bitstream.This flag can be set during compilation for a NON PS instantiated
* bitstream
*
* ECC_ENABLE
* This flag will be defined in the ps7_init.h file when ECC is enabled
* in the DDR configuration (XPS GUI)
*
* RSA_SUPPORT
* This flag is used to enable authentication feature
* Default this macro disabled, reason to avoid increase in code size
*
* MMC_SUPPORT
* This flag is used to enable MMC support feature
*
* JTAG_ENABLE_LEVEL_SHIFTERS
* FSBL will not enable the level shifters for jtag boot mode. This flag can be
* set during compilation for jtag boot mode to enable level shifters.
*
* FORCE_USE_AES_EXCLUDE
* Defining this flag will exclude the feature, forcing every partition to be
* encrypted when EFUSE_SEC_EN bit is set.
* This flag can be set/unset during compilation.
* By default this flag is unset/undefined which enables the above feature
* Note : Changing the default behaviour is not recommended from
* Security perspective.
*
*******************************************************************************/
